    Description
    Students learn an ancient form of hatha yoga (the physical movement of yoga) along with breathing and meditation techniques. Brief lectures covering yoga history, diaphragmatic breathing, basic anatomical alignment of yoga poses, body awareness, and stress management are presented. Students practice the 25 basic asanas (yoga poses) with modifications to each asanas, and alignment principles (forward folds, twists, backbends, and standing poses, etc.).
